Shawnee Little Theatre will continue its ongoing capital improvements drive by joining with Oklahoma Baptist University to present the Stephen Sondheim musical “Into the Woods” Feb. 9-20.
Proceeds from this season extra production will help fund lighting and sound improvements to the SLT facility, 1829 Airport Road. A fund drive last summer raised over $65,000 to expand rest rooms and remodel the lobby area. Ongoing technical upgrades estimated at $25,000 to aging lighting and sound equipment, will further the local community theatre’s emphasis on quality of production.
“Into the Woods” is the ninth time SLT and OBU have combined talents to produce a town and gown production.
University students will receive college credit in musical theatre production for their participation onstage and behind the scenes.
Directed by Gregory Hopkins with musical direction by Mark McQuade and Jennifer McQuade, the show will perform Feb. 12, 13, 17, 18, 19 and 20 at 7:30 p.m. There will be a 2 p.m. matinee on Feb. 14.
